The choice of blue for the Facebook icon was not a haphazard one. Color theory suggests that blue evokes feelings of trust, security, and reliability – qualities essential for a platform built on connecting people. This strategic use of color has undoubtedly contributed to Facebook's widespread adoption and its enduring association with these core values.

Common Questions about the Blue Facebook Icon Aesthetic

1. Why is blue such a popular color for tech companies?

Blue is often associated with trust, reliability, and communication, making it a fitting choice for technology companies aiming to build credibility and user confidence.

2. Has Facebook ever changed its icon color?

While Facebook has experimented with different shades of blue and temporary logo variations, the core blue color of the icon has remained consistent.

7. What are the psychological effects of the color blue?

Blue is often associated with calmness, serenity, and security. It can also evoke feelings of trust, dependability, and professionalism.

8. Is there a specific shade of blue that is most effective for icons?

There is no one-size-fits-all answer, but bright, vibrant blues tend to be eye-catching, while darker blues can convey a sense of sophistication and trustworthiness.
